The times for three swimmers are 101.85 seconds, 101.6 seconds, and 59.625 seconds. Which is the winning time?

Mathematics
2 answers:
disa [49]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

the 59.625 second swimmer.

Step-by-step explanation:

the time for the swimmer to finish the race is the least, so it was the fastest time
